Compensation for Victims of Street Racing Accidents in Texas

The exhilarating thrill of street racing has been romanticized by box-office hits, TV shows, and even social media. However, the truth is that this risky activity can lead to both fatalities and dire financial repercussions for individuals engaged. It also results in hundreds of street racing injury claims in Texas each year. Due to the terrible consequences of street racing accidents, the state legislature has taken action to regulate this activity. Senate Bill 1495 and House Bill 1315 raised the classification of some driving crimes from a Class B to a Class A misdemeanor. These rules increased fines and potential jail terms when a reckless motorist causes harm or death to others.

Victims of a negligent driver who was racing are entitled to Texas street racing accident compensation, according to the law.

Available Compensation for Victims of Street Racing Accidents in Texas

The law is very clear when it comes to compensation for victims of street racing:

Medical Expenses

Victims, both motorists and pedestrians, may seek reimbursement for hospital bills, doctors' visits, medication, rehabilitative care, and other medical expenses.

Lost Wages

Any victim who missed work to recover from injuries can recover lost income for the days that he or she was unable to work.

Pain and Suffering

This is the most important form of compensation, especially in the case of wrongful death. Although no monetary amount can truly compensate for the loss of a loved one, you can seek damages for loss of companionship, emotional distress, and mental anguish caused by the death of a family member.

Insurance Companies and Street Racing Accidents

In Texas, drivers are required to have a minimum amount of liability insurance to cover the costs of accidents they might cause. These minimums are often referred to as 30/60/25 coverage, a shorthand for:

  1. $30,000 per person for bodily injury
  2. $60,000 per accident for bodily injury
  3. $25,000 per accident for property damage

Insurers may deny coverage for accidents resulting from illegal racing, leaving the at-fault driver responsible for the full costs of the accident. This puts the driver in a precarious financial situation and leaves little recourse for the victims to seek compensation.

How UIM/UM Coverage Can Help in Street Racing Accidents

Sadly, street racing often involves stolen vehicles, which further complicates insurance coverage. Stolen cars used in street racing might not be covered by comprehensive insurance since it's a deliberate crime rather than an unexpected event.

In these cases, uninsured/underinsured motorist (UIM/UM) coverage becomes critical when victims seek compensation after being involved in a street racing accident. UIM/UM coverage can help victims recoup their losses if the at-fault driver is uninsured or underinsured, particularly when they lack adequate insurance due to illegal activities.
